Output 20665f793aea054889d92acf3f88ec57d62a6184b6795a3fc10e9c011baf6a49:1

value
1873148
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44f76633e2558c64a6a71d9942bd9501184f104f OP_EQUALVERIFY OP_CHECKSIG
address
17HfKeNK8HYEKo24pXGBagtF4uc4bcX7GK
transaction
20665f793aea054889d92acf3f88ec57d62a6184b6795a3fc10e9c011baf6a49
spent
true